位置:首页 > 行业软件 > Excel精确计算年龄到月的公式方法

Excel精确计算年龄到月的公式方法

时间:2026-06-22  |  作者:318050  |  阅读:0

处理员工档案、统计分析或会员管理时,常常需要一个精确的年龄数据(具体到多少年多少月)。这比单纯计算周岁更有用。

在 Excel 和 WPS 里,完成这个任务只需用好一个系统自带但不常被注意的函数:DATEDIF

什么是 DATEDIF 函数?

顾名思义,DATEDIF 用于计算两个日期之间的差值。它的语法很简单:=DATEDIF(开始日期, 结束日期, 单位)

关键在于第三个参数“单位”,它决定返回结果是年、月还是天。常用的单位有:

  • "y" —— 年
  • "m" —— 月
  • "d" —— 日

如何精确到月?

操作并不复杂。假设你有一份数据:A 列是出生日期,B 列是当前日期(或截止日期)。我们想在 C 列计算出精确到月的年龄。

在 C2 单元格输入以下公式即可:

=DATEDIF(A2,B2,"y")&"年"&DATEDIF(A2,B2,"ym")&"个月"

公式拆解

第一部分 DATEDIF(A2,B2,"y"):计算从出生到“今天”之间,完整度过了多少“整年”。它会自动忽略不足一年的零头月份和天数。

Excel精确计算年龄到月的公式方法_wishdown.com

第二部分 DATEDIF(A2,B2,"ym"):这是关键。参数 "ym" 表示计算两个日期之间相差的月数,但忽略年份。它只关心在同一年份里,你出生日所在的月份到当前月份之间隔了几个月。

将这两部分用连接符 & 组合,中间加上“年”和“个月”这两个中文单位,一个清晰易读、精确到月的年龄就计算出来了。

举例说明

  • 假设 A2 是 1990 年 5 月 1 日,B2 是 2024 年 10 月 15 日。
  • 第一部分计算整年:结果是 33 年(从 1990 年到 2023 年)。
  • 第二部分计算忽略年份的月份:从 5 月到 10 月,结果是 5 个月

最终,C2 单元格会清晰显示为“33年5个月”。

这个方法在 WPS 表格里完全适用,操作与 Excel 一模一样。掌握了这个公式,无论是 HR 统计员工司龄、会员系统分析用户生命周期,还是其他需要精确时间跨度的场景,你都能快速搞定,省去手动加减推算的麻烦。数据的准确性和工作效率自然就上去了。

来源:整理自互联网
免责声明:文中图文均来自网络,如有侵权请联系删除,心愿游戏发布此文仅为传递信息,不代表心愿游戏认同其观点或证实其描述。

相关文章

更多

精选合集

更多

大家都在玩

热门话题

大家都在看

更多